Resident 🎀Evil 4 remake fans aren't sure if they like biologist Luis' new face, with some even going as far as calling it "ugly." 

Last night Capcom treated fans to yet another Resident Evil showcase, this time focusing on the soon-to-release Resident Evil Village Gold Edition and the Resident Evil 4 Remake. During the showcase, we got to see some 澳洲幸运5开奖号码历史查询:Resident Evil 4 Remake gameplay as well as a brief new story trailer that features more ꦯof Leon Kennedy, Ada Wong, Ashley Graham, and Luis Sera.

If you didn't know, the Resident Evil 4 remake is set to follow in the footsteps of its older siblings 澳洲幸运5开奖号码历史查询:Resident Evil 2 and 澳洲幸运5开奖号码历史查询:Resident Evil 3, which also got the remake treatment back in 2019 and 202. Players will be able to play the shiny new version of Resident Evil 4 when it releases on PS5, PS4, 澳洲幸运5开奖号码历史查询:Xbox Series X, and PC on March 24, 2023.
